MANILA – The Department of Agriculture is mulling the possibility of lifting the ban on exporting unprocessed coconut, Agriculture Secretary Emmanuel Piol said Friday.
The official announced this on the same day he confirmed that China is “interested” in sourcing coconuts from the country.
China’s coconut milk-producing Hainan province imports 200 million coconuts from Vietnam, Thailand and India, and is looking to buy more from the Philippines, the third biggest coconut producer in the world, Piol said in a statement.
